407 Caribou St, Simla, CO 80835

POSSIBLE RESIDENT(S):
SIMLA STATS:
Total population 693
Males
308
Females
385
Median Household Income $43,167
Source: U.S. Census Bureau, 2018
NEARBY ADDRESSES IN 80835:
308 Ute Ave, Simla, CO 80835
204 Adams St Ste 3, Simla, CO 80835-9428
101 Sioux Ave, Simla, CO 80835
514 Cheyenne Ave, Simla, CO 80835
206 Washington Ave, Simla, CO 80835